The main difference between prednisone and prednisolone is that prednisone must be converted by liver enzymes to prednisolone before it can work. In people with severe liver disease, prednisolone is usually preferred. Prednisone is known as a prodrug which is defined as a biologically inactive compound …

WebPrednisone belongs to a class of drugs known as corticosteroids. It decreases your immune system's response to various diseases to reduce symptoms such as swelling and allergic-type reactions.
WebNov 1, 2024 · Methylprednisolone is more potent than prednisone.
